Do you experience lightheadedness along with neck pain?
While lightheadedness isn't directly discussed in relation to spondylitis neck pain, neck issues from spondylitis can certainly cause various symptoms. Many people with spondylitis experience neck pain, especially when the condition affects the cervical spine (upper spine).
Neck pain from spondylitis is inflammatory in nature, meaning it often feels worse with rest and improves with movement. This is different from mechanical pain that gets better with rest.
Some MySpondylitisTeam members have described experiencing headaches that radiate from the back of the head, along with pressure and pain. One member mentioned having "a spinal headache and pressure that's radiating from the back of my head to my middle back."
Cervical spine involvement is common:
- About 45% of people with spondylitis develop cervical spine inflammation after 10 years
- This increases to 70% after 20 years with the condition
- People with cervical spondylitis experience headaches at about 2.5 times the rate of those without it
If you're experiencing lightheadedness with neck pain, it's important to discuss this with your healthcare provider. Physical therapy can be helpful for cervical spine symptoms, and your physical therapist can guide you through specific exercises that may help.
